About Purple Bhut Jolokia Pepper

The Purple Bhut Jolokia pepper is a small but mighty chili that is not for the faint of heart. This pepper is a cross between the well-known Bhut Jolokia pepper and an unknown purple chili variety. It boasts a bold, smoky flavor with hints of sweetness. Though it is relatively unknown, it packs a fiery punch and is not to be underestimated.

The Purple Bhut Jolokia pepper originates from the northeastern region of India, specifically Assam and Nagaland. It is a member of the Capsicum chinense species. This chili plant typically grows to be about 2-3 feet tall and produces small, slender purple peppers that are about 1-2 inches in length. This chili pepper is incredibly hot, with a Scoville rating of around 800,000 to 1,000,000 units.

This chili starts out with a sweet, almost fruity taste that quickly gives way to a smoky, intense heat. The flavor is not for everyone, but those who love spicy food will appreciate the complexity and intensity of this pepper.
